Fix autovacuum's database sorting.
When db_comparator() was updated to use pg_cmp_s32(), the arguments
were listed in the wrong order. This caused autovacuum to sort the
databases by their scores in ascending order instead of descending
order. To fix, swap the arguments to pg_cmp_s32().
Oversight in commit 3b42bdb471.
